| package org.apache.jena.sparql.engine.join; |
| |
| import java.util.Iterator; |
| import java.util.List; |
| |
| import org.apache.jena.atlas.iterator.Iter; |
| import org.apache.jena.sparql.algebra.Algebra; |
| import org.apache.jena.sparql.engine.ExecutionContext; |
| import org.apache.jena.sparql.engine.QueryIterator; |
| import org.apache.jena.sparql.engine.binding.Binding; |
| import org.apache.jena.sparql.engine.iterator.QueryIter2; |
| import org.apache.jena.sparql.expr.ExprList ; |
| |
| /** |
| * Nested Loop left Join (materializing on the right, streaming on the left) |
| * A simple, dependable join. |
| * <p> |
| * See {@link Join#nestedLoopLeftJoinBasic} for a very simple implementation for |
| * testing purposes only. |
| */ |
| public class QueryIterNestedLoopLeftJoin extends QueryIter2 { |
| // XXX Can we materialise left instead? |
| |
| private long s_countLHS = 0; |
| private long s_countRHS = 0; |
| private long s_countResults = 0; |
| |
| private final ExprList conditions; |
| private final List<Binding> rightRows; |
| private Iterator<Binding> right = null; |
| private QueryIterator left; |
| private Binding rowLeft = null; |
| private boolean foundMatch ; |
| |
| private Binding slot = null; |
| private boolean finished = false; |
| |
| public QueryIterNestedLoopLeftJoin(QueryIterator left, QueryIterator right, ExprList exprList, ExecutionContext cxt) { |
| super(left, right, cxt); |
| conditions = exprList ; |
| rightRows = Iter.toList(right); |
| s_countRHS = rightRows.size(); |
| this.left = left; |
| } |
| |
| @Override |
| protected boolean hasNextBinding() { |
| if ( finished ) |
| return false; |
| if ( slot == null ) { |
| slot = moveToNextBindingOrNull(); |
| if ( slot == null ) { |
| close(); |
| return false; |
| } |
| } |
| return true; |
| } |
| |
| @Override |
| protected Binding moveToNextBinding() { |
| Binding r = slot; |
| slot = null; |
| return r; |
| } |
| |
| protected Binding moveToNextBindingOrNull() { |
| if ( isFinished() ) |
| return null; |
| |
| for ( ;; ) { // For rows from the left |
| if ( rowLeft == null ) { |
| if ( left.hasNext() ) { |
| rowLeft = left.next(); |
| foundMatch = false ; |
| s_countLHS++; |
| right = rightRows.iterator(); |
| } else |
| return null; |
| } |
| |
| while (right.hasNext()) { |
| Binding rowRight = right.next(); |
| Binding r = Algebra.merge(rowLeft, rowRight); |
| if ( r != null && applyConditions(r) ) { |
| s_countResults++; |
| foundMatch = true ; |
| return r; |
| } |
| } |
| if ( ! foundMatch ) { |
| s_countResults++; |
| Binding r = rowLeft ; |
| rowLeft = null; |
| return r ; |
| } |
| rowLeft = null; |
| } |
| } |
| |
| private boolean applyConditions(Binding binding) { |
| if ( conditions == null ) |
| return true ; |
| return conditions.isSatisfied(binding, getExecContext()) ; |
| } |
| |
| @Override |
| protected void requestSubCancel() {} |
| |
| @Override |
| protected void closeSubIterator() { |
| if ( JoinLib.JOIN_EXPLAIN ) { |
| String x = String.format("InnerLoopJoin: LHS=%d RHS=%d Results=%d", s_countLHS, s_countRHS, s_countResults); |
| System.out.println(x); |
| } |
| } |
| } |
